''[[https://forum.arcgames.com/startrekonline/discussion/comment/13177470/#Comment_13177470 Two Sides of a Coin]]'' is a ''VideoGame/StarTrekOnline'' fanfic by Tropers/StarSword, set in the ''Fanfic/BaitAndSwitchSTO'' universe. It was adapted from the Foundry mission "The Interwarp Experiment" by [=AstroRobLA=].

Captain Kanril Eleya of the ''Galaxy''-class starship USS ''Bajor'' is diverted from a course to join Allied forces in the Delta Quadrant after being personally requested by for a classified mission. The mission turns out to be a project to develop a new form of FasterThanLightTravel, headed by her [[TheOneThatGotAway old flame]], Commander Jerrod Dalton. As things GoHorriblyWrong, Eleya is forced to deal with her lingering feelings for him while trying to save the lives of everyone involved in the project.

The first half of ''Two Sides of a Coin'' was originally written for [[http://www.arcgames.com/en/forums/startrekonline/#/discussion/1181487/ulc-9-in-memory-of-spock Unofficial Literary Challenge 9: "In Memory of Spock"]], but the author became distracted by other endeavors and didn't finish the second half until almost two years later.

!!Tropes:
* BoardingParty: The Romulans board USS ''Destiny'' trying to get the interwarp technology. Eleya leads her assault team to counterattack them.
* DrowningMySorrows: Eleya gets wasted on Romulan ale after [[spoiler:Dalton dies]] and complains that "it takesh a lot to get me good and drunk theshe daysh."
* DyingDeclarationOfLove: [[spoiler:Dalton {{flatline}}s while telling Eleya, "I love you. I never stopped loving..."]]
* {{Epigraph}}: The original version of part one used [[https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=6yYchgX1fMw "A Matter of Trust"]] by Music/BillyJoel. The rerelease uses [[https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=F0F2yComQ1U "Brave Enough"]] by Music/LindseyStirling for part one, and [[https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=x7n0iizglK0 "Love/Hate Heartbreak"]] by Music/{{Halestorm}} for part two.
* FromBadToWorse: {{Lampshaded}} after Eleya realizes just how totally screwed they all are. [[spoiler:A Romulan collaborator]] triggers the interwarp drive, a warp bubble fifty kilometers across that drags an AsteroidThicket along with Eleya's ship. Oh, and it's invisible to sensors.
-->'''Eleya:''' ''(looks skyward)'' Right! Because the Prophets just couldn’t be done ''phekk’sha mab sor’ah''! You ''phekk’ta'' built a giant, '''''invisible''' phekk’ta'' warp drive!?\\
'''Dalton:''' I didn’t know for sure, damn it! The math wasn’t exact, El, any number of real-world conditions could’ve factored in. I needed to test it to see what would happen… before I knew. But that means we have to shut it down, and fast,or we could end up on the other side of the quadrant before anyone realizes we’re missing.\\
'''Eleya:''' Oh, right, this thing is also slipstream-fast, because of course it is. ''({{facepalm}})''
* HeyYouHaymaker: Eleya reintroduces herself to Dalton with tap on the shoulder, then a right cross that breaks one of her fingers and sends him flying.
* HowDareYouDieOnMe: When Dalton starts showing symptoms of [[spoiler:fatal radiation poisoning]], he and Eleya have this exchange as she carries him clear of an expected explosion:
-->'''Dalton:''' Carrying me over the threshold?\\
'''Eleya:''' Shut up, I'm not finished with you. You stay alive, you damn fool.
* IfYouEverDoAnythingToHurtHer: PlayedForDrama. Dalton threatens Gaarra [[spoiler:while dying of massive radiation poisoning]] that if he breaks Eleya's heart like he did, Dalton will [[spoiler:come back and haunt him]].
* MauveShirt: Petty Officer zh'Planathalian survived the Breen in "Fanfic/{{Frostbite}}". [[spoiler:She doesn't survive the Romulans here.]]
* MinorInjuryOverreaction: From Lt. Kate [=McMillan=], after being shot in the leg. [[spoiler:The [[ArtificialLimbs prosthetic leg]].]]
-->"Sweet mother of holy ''fuck'', asswipe hobgoblin shot my goddamn ''leg''!"
* OldFlame: Eleya and Dalton met at the Academy in ''Fanfic/FromBajorToTheBlack'' but he left her so he could take early graduation and a plum assignment. Several years later in this story, he specifically requests her because despite their confused feelings for each other, he knows she's completely trustworthy.
* ShoutOut: As Eleya bitterly narrates in the epilogue:
-->"Back to ''Bajor''. Back to the war. There’s always the war, the endless struggle for one more stupid chunk of rock in one more stupid sector, [[TabletopGame/{{Warhammer 40000}} the killing, the dying, the laughter of thirsting gods]]."
* SlashedThroat: Eleya kills a Romulan with a bayonet across the throat.
* SnipingTheCockpit: An {{exaggerated}} example. After battering down IRW ''Javelin'''s forward shields, Tess lands a pinpoint phaser shot that barely slips through the edge of a shield hole before it can bring fresh shields around and wipes out the bridge. ''Javelin'' crashes into an asteroid before the engineering crew can regain control.
* TractorBeam: Eleya uses a tractor beam to throw a Romulan warbird into another, taking them both out.
